Can you tell me a little bit about how you got started as a photographer? 
Lauren and I (Kris) both have art degrees. I have a Studio Art degree in ceramics/sculpture and I learned photography so I could take film slides of my work for gallery shows. Lauren has a B.F.A. in photography and comes from a long line of photographers in her family. Lauren tells a great story of her dad giving her a Pentax K1000 when she was 10 yrs old then teaching her how to make darkroom color prints from film around the same age. From film to digital, we have come a long way in the photography world. Now we are finding that many customers love the vintage style film packages we offer, so are are happy to have that solid background in film photography.

How do you make wedding and engagement sessions different?
We try to stay away from the boring overly traditional posing and allow the client's personalities to shine through in the photos. In every shot we attempt to use dynamic ideas and lighting to achieve something that is in and of itself beautiful. We use a mix of film and digital and whatever else we can to make each image tell a story. We try very hard to not over edit and over work an image in the computer, allowing the image to come alive with minimal post-processing.
